ETSU Edges UNC Asheville 2-1 in Double Overtime
09.25.2010 | Men's Soccer
JOHNSON CITY, TENN. - Aaron Schonfeld's goal in the 103rd minute gave East Tennessee State a 2-1 double overtime win over visiting UNC Asheville Saturday evening at Buccaneer Field.
The snakebit Bulldogs (2-5) lost their fourth straight match with the last three being by just one goal.
Asheville had tied the match in the 36th minute when freshman Kenneth Lingerfelt scored his first career goal to make the match 1-1.
The Buccaneers (5-2-0) out-shot the Bulldogs on the night 26-12 but goalkeeper Lassi Hurskainen made four saves to keep the game tied.
David Geno gave the home team the lead with a goal in the 18th minute for a 1-0 ETSU advantage.
